[英]How to list "Get Started" vignette under both "Get Started" and "Articles" in pkgdown site for R package?
這類似於如何將“入門”移動到 pkgdown 中的文章,但我希望共享 package 名稱的文章同時列在“入門”和“文章”列表下。 簡單地在 _pkgdown.yml 中的文章列表下列_pkgdown.yml似乎並不會強制它顯示在那里: ...
[英]How to list "Get Started" vignette under both "Get Started" and "Articles" in pkgdown site for R package?
這類似於如何將“入門”移動到 pkgdown 中的文章,但我希望共享 package 名稱的文章同時列在“入門”和“文章”列表下。 簡單地在 _pkgdown.yml 中的文章列表下列_pkgdown.yml似乎並不會強制它顯示在那里: ...
[英]How to successfully use {pkgdown} when `svglite` graphics device is used
賞金將在 12 小時后到期。 此問題的答案有資格獲得+100聲望賞金。 Indrajeet Patil想讓更多人關注這個問題。 為了解決我的 R package 中的一個問題,我想嘗試使用svglite圖形設備來渲染ggplot圖:knitr::opts_chunk$set(dev = "svg ...
[英]How to move "Get Started" to articles in pkgdown
通常,pkgdown 網站的導航欄中有一個“入門”部分。 然而,我得到的用戶反饋是,人們只看自述文件中的示例,然后點擊文章,甚至沒有注意到這一部分。 “入門”文章來自與包同名的小插圖(參見https://pkgdown.r-lib.org/reference/build_articles.html ...
[英]How to have `pkgdown` use figure numbers and cross-references in vignettes?
我為 package 創建了幾個 vi.nette,其中包含我想在文本中引用的數字。 使用.Rmd vi.nette 的模板,我可以通過在我的 yaml header 中使用bookdown::html_document2來做到這一點: 然而,當我建立相關的pkgdown站點時,我沒有得到圖號或交 ...
[英]pkgdown build_site example not rendering
我在兩個文件中有以下示例@examples x <- mtcars$mpg some_func_here(x) some_func_here(x)失敗,因為它說x未找到... 以下是示例失敗的兩個頁面: bootstrap_p_augment AND bootstrap_p_vec 以下 ...
[英]How to make tables appear with desired kableExtra theme on pkgdown website?
賞金將在 6 天后到期。 此問題的答案有資格獲得+50聲望賞金。 mikeytop正在從有信譽的來源尋找答案。 我正在使用pkgdown來構建我的 package 網站。 但是,當使用kableExtra::kable_classic顯示在我的網站中標題為“panelsummary 簡介”的小插 ...
[英]pkgdown action failing at build XML
還有其他人在 pkgdown github 操作中遇到過這個錯誤嗎? 看起來像是構建 XML package 本身的錯誤,不確定我是否可以做些什么。 在 github action output 看起來會出現這樣的錯誤。 它們看起來特定於 XML 中的內部函數。 ...
[英]pkgdown workflow fails to deploy gh pages
我為我的 R 包存儲庫設置了一個pkgdown工作流程。 .github/workflows/pkgdown.yaml文件: pkgdown工作流程運行良好,但無法更新 GitHub 頁面。 我按照 GitHub 文檔中的說明設置了gh-pages分支,因此存在工作流pages-build- ...
[英]Reticulate fails automatic configuration in R package
我正在開發一個 R 包,它利用reticulate調用我實現的 Python 包的一些功能,可通過pip安裝。 根據它的文檔,我在我的包的DESCRIPTION文件中設置了 Python 依賴項的reticulate自動配置,如下所示: 其中my_python_package是我需要使用的 P ...
[英]Plots in function documentation do not display correctly
我正在編寫一個 R 包及其文檔,使用roxygen2來記錄我的功能,並使用pkgdown來創建 github 頁面。 package 是關於光柵的,所以我在 function 文檔的示例中包含了一些光柵 plot。 當示例在控制台中運行時,一切看起來都很好。 當它們通過pkgdown packag ...
[英]pkgdown::build_site() not capturing R package logo in HTML renders
我最近pkgdown了一台裝有 Windows 11 的新筆記本電腦(盡管我的sessionInfo()聲明的是 Windows 10 ),我正在嘗試為我正在開發的 R 包構建一個pkgdown站點。 這不是我過去遇到的問題。 運行命令pkgdown::build_site()不會正確地將我的自定義 ...
[英]Unable to push Package Website (pkgdown from R) to GitHub
我使用 pkgdown 包為我的包創建了一個新網站,該網站將托管在 Github 上。 我運行了以下代碼: 函數pkgdown::build_site在我的本地pkgdown::build_site中生成了一個子文件夾docs\\ 。 您可以在下面的照片中看到(紅色箭頭)。 我需要將此docs\ ...
[英]pkgdown::deploy_to_branch() SSL cert error
一段時間以來,我一直在使用pkgdown::deploy_to_branch()將我的文檔發布到我的 repo 的gh-pages分支上,但從本周開始它停止工作並開始給我以下錯誤: 當我嘗試調試並深入了解 function 時,這是我嘗試直接調用build_site()時遇到的錯誤: 不可否認,各 ...
[英]Vignette fails to be built by pkgdown
我有一個 R package,我正在嘗試為其設置pkgdown 。 我按照此處的說明進行操作,並且正在運行build_site()來生成 docs 目錄。 運行此命令時,我收到錯誤 顯示在嘗試渲染其中一個小插曲時構建失敗。 但是,如果我只是嘗試在一個新的交互式 session 中編織這個小插圖,它 ...
[英]How to add extra files to pkgdown site?
我有一個 package 包含一些 Javascript 代碼以及 R 代碼。 我可以使用pkgdown為 package 中的 R 文檔建立一個由 Github 托管的網站,方法是正確設置並運行 我還可以使用JSDoc建立一個本地網站,記錄 Javascript 代碼,並將其放在pkgdown使 ...
[英]How can I manually create links within a {pkgdown} site?
pkgdown自動鏈接小插圖詳細介紹了 package 如何在網站中創建鏈接,包括網站本身的其他頁面和其他軟件包的文檔。 我想知道是否有一種簡單的方法可以復制它。 例如,是否有一個 function 可以在構建站點時在其中運行,例如generate_pkgdown_link("my_functi ...
[英]pkgdown fails parsing Rd files when examples are added
由於某種原因, pkgdown無法解析我的 package 中的一個.Rd 文件。 當我使用@examples標記或@example inst/example/add.R替代方法將示例添加到roxygen2文檔時,我發現它失敗了。 我將我的 function 最小化為兩個 arguments 以使其 ...
[英]How to add pre-commit git hooks to check that README.Rmd and index.Rmd have been knitted?
我有一個帶有 pkgdown 文檔站點的 R package。 我想創建一個 git 掛鈎,這樣如果我嘗試提交並將更改推送到README.Rmd或index.Rmd而不先編織它們以創建相應的.Md文件,我會收到警告。 現在我只是忘記了。 R Packages一書說使用usethis::use_r ...
[英]Git doesn't know my name/email when Github Actions deploy R package documentation and breaks
一段時間以來,我一直在愉快地使用 Github 的 Actions 來運行我的庫的R CMD check和部署包的文檔。 突然, package 操作開始失敗,並出現以下錯誤: 我試過用我的名字和 RStudio 終端上的 email 運行這些命令,從我編碼的不同計算機上嘗試過,檢查pkgdown: ...
[英]Supress long html output with kable_styling
我的 package 中的一個函數使用kable()和kable_styling()生成一個表。 當我運行此代碼時,我在查看器中看到 output 和控制台中的長 HTML 代碼。 我在 Rmd 中看到了排除 HTML output 的解決方案,但沒有看到 function 的解決方案。 它也只在 ...